These letters both explained the new Constitution and answered the charges of the Anti-Federalists. The letters were collected into a volume called "The Federalist," or "The Federalist Papers." Though the influence of The Federalist at the time is questionable, the letters are noted today as classics in political theory.

The Anti-Federalists. Although less well-organized than the Federalists, the Anti-Federalists also had an impressive group of leaders who were especially prominent in state politics. In spite of the diversity that characterized the Anti-Federalist opposition, they did share a core view of American politics.
